The AMD Phenom II X4 'Deneb' Quad-Core processor has been the workhorse of the AMD desktop lineup since 2009 and today it received a new flagship model to give a much needed performance boost. The AMD Phenom II X4 980 Black Edition processor operates at 3.7GHz and becomes the fastest desktop processor that AMD has ever released. The AMD Phenom II X4 980 Black Edition Processor features the highest clock speed of any that AMD has released, but it's on core architecture that is over two years old and it shows in the benchmarks. It gets the job done, but is clearly pushing the limits of what AMD can expect from Deneb.
